Indian Harbour Beach
Founded on June 6, 1955, Indian Harbour Beach is 2.6 square miles of oceanfront community.
It is located on the barrier island just north of Indialantic and south of Satellite Beach. The Eau Gallie Caseway connect Indian Harbour Beach to Melbourne on the mainland.
The 2004 US Census estimates the population at 8,503 with a median household income of $42,889.
Due to fiscal planning, Indian Harbour Beach has no long term indebtedness. This makes the tax rate among the lowest in Brevard County.
Indian Harbour Beach provides facilities for tennis, baseball, soccer, golfing, swimming and fishing.
Gleason Park is a 27 acre facility surrounding a lake with exercise paths, pavilions, a heated pool, and community center.
Indian Harbour Beach is a mostly residential community with shopping centers, stores, and a wide variety of restaurants.
